Title: People Experience Specialist

Location: Denver, Colorado (Hybrid role once training is complete)

Level: Entry-Level Professional – Human Resources Reports To: Director, People Strategy & Experience

Compensation: $65,000 - $75,000 + 10% bonus

____________________________________________________________________________________

JOB PURPOSE

Support HR operations across the employee lifecycle, including onboarding, offboarding, payroll coordination, data management, and compliance.
Ensure accurate and timely HR processes, maintain data integrity, and support consistent employee experience and payroll administration.

RESPONSIBILITIES

Employee Lifecycle Support

  • Coordinate onboarding, preboarding, and offboarding processes, ensuring accurate and timely completion of all documentation and system updates
  • Schedule onboarding sessions and support orientation with leaders
  • Guide managers, new hires, and departing employees through HR processes
  • Identify and recommend improvements to lifecycle workflows

Payroll & HR Data Administration

  • Maintain accurate employee records, timekeeping, and PTO data to support payroll processing
  • Assist Payroll Specialist with administrative support and employee payroll inquiries
  • Compile and distribute recurring HR reports (weekly, monthly, quarterly, annual)
  • Ensure HR data integrity for reporting, compliance, and payroll accuracy

Employee Experience & Engagement

  • Support recognition programs, milestone tracking, and employee rewards initiatives
  • Coordinate engagement events, trainings, and annual company gatherings
  • Manage onboarding materials and employee swag distribution
  • Support engagement communications and tracking programs

HR Support, Compliance & Stakeholders

  • Provide guidance on HR policies, processes, and procedures
  • Escalate employee relations and complex issues to HR partners as needed
  • Identify and report compliance issues related to policies and regulations
  • Support change management initiatives through communication and coordination
  • Coordinate meetings, materials, and actions across stakeholders

EDUCATION

  •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ent experience

EXPERIENCE

  • 1–3 years of HR, payroll, or administrative experience
  • Ability to work independently with limited supervision
  • 7–12 months of team support experience preferred

Meriton has deep experience and a strong track record of success in the commercial HVAC industry. Our team makes long-term investments in top-tier, independent companies and brings them together to maximize our collective potential. Our portfolio has a footprint spread across 13 U.S. states between ten businesses: Air Equipment Company, CFM Company, Custom Mechanical Solutions, Engineered Equipment, Inc., HVAC RNTL, Integrated Cooling Solutions, Mechanical Products Nevada, Mechanical Products Southwest, Texas AirSystems and Vicon Equipment. For more information about our portfolio, visit our website. We are the leading network of exclusive manufacturers’ representatives in commercial and industrial HVAC equipment. Our business is driven by trusted relationships with manufacturer partners, building owners, contractors, engineers, and architects. At Meriton, our name embodies our team spirit and collaborative approach. It’s a combination of the words “merit” and “peloton”. Our company's legacy is rooted in the idea of 'merit' representing the hard work we put in to earn every win. Peloton, refers to cyclists who ride closely together to save energy and reduce wind resistance to help each other perform better in a race. That’s what we do here. Ride as a team. Reduce headwinds.
